On Tue, 27 May 2025 15:57:56 +0200, Stefan Hanreich wrote:
> Since we now have proxmox-log as the standard crate for logging purposes,
> migrate proxmox-firewall to the new logging crate.
> 
> The old logging setup was also tied with the debugging mechanisms described in
> the documentation. I used that opportunity to implement specific subcommands for
> debugging proxmox-firewall, instead of just relying solely on the log output.
